Sadie Sink cast in Tom Holland's ‘Spider-Man 4’; fans ask 'Mary Jane or Jean Grey'

‘Stranger Things’ breakout star, Sadie Sink has officially joined the Marvel Cinematic Universe.
The actress has reportedly been cast in a leading role in the highly anticipated ‘Spider-Man 4’ film, which will see Tom Holland reprise his role as Peter Parker, aka Spider-Man. Directed by Destin Daniel Cretton, the film is set to begin shooting later this year, Deadline reports.
While details of Sink’s character remain under wraps, speculation is rife among fans that she may be introduced as Jean Grey, a key member of the X-Men. With Marvel Studios’ closer to incorporating the mutants into the MCU, chances are that fans will get to see Jean with her telekinetic and telepathic abilities. However, some believe she could be playing another well-known red-haired character in Spider-Man lore—possibly Spider-Man’s new love interest – Mary Jane Watson. It is commonly believed that Zendaya had already played the role of MJ in the trilogy, however, some fans note that her character’s name in the film was Michelle “MJ” Jones.
The casting decision comes at a pivotal moment in the Spider-Man franchise. Sadie’s casting comes at a time when everyone in the MCU has no memory of Peter Parker being Spider-Man, following the events of ‘Spider-Man: No Way Home’ where Peter, with the help of Benedict Cumberbatch’s Doctor Strange, chooses to erase his existence from the memories of everyone, including those he loved.
With Sink’s character expected to have a major presence in the film, her involvement hints at significant new storylines for the beloved superhero.
Currently, Holland is filming Christopher Nolan’s ‘The Odyssey’ and is expected to begin work on ‘Spider-Man 4’ once that production wraps. He is also rumoured to be heading to London to shoot for ‘Avengers: Doomsday’, where he is expected to join the Russo Brothers, and cast members including Robert Downey Jr, Chris Hemsworth and many others.
For Sink, this new role arrives as she bids farewell to ‘Stranger Things,’ which is set to conclude with its final season airing later this year.
Currently, Spider-Man 4 is slated for a July 2026 release.
